Ynet – The 19th Knesset’s first summer session on Monday turned into a barbed verbal bout between Finance Minister Yair Lapid and haredi Knesset members.
Answering haredi criticism of the impending budget cuts, Lapid cynically said: “I understand you’re going through tough times. Weren’t you sitting in the government which created the deficit? Where you on Mars? You were in every government, and you were costly partners.”
